Transaction 0906dce99339290b944da14bb3d7db51e929d0f7d2e04e30d950fde25bd2eac9
1 Input
1 Output
-
0906dce99339290b944da14bb3d7db51e929d0f7d2e04e30d950fde25bd2eac9:0
- value
- 660645
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c5d9f730681cdb593c89f27bb9b3af476a38ec8
- address
- bc1q33we7ucxs8xmty7gnunmhxe673m28rkgkc5jt7